"
Outrageous" is a song recorded by American singer
Britney Spears for her fourth studio album,
In the Zone (2003). It was written and produced by
R. Kelly, with vocal production provided by
Trixster and Penelope Magnet. The song was released on July 20, 2004, by
Jive Records, as the fourth and final single from
In the Zone. "Outrageous" was the record label's choice for first and second single, but Spears pushed for "
Me Against the Music" and "
Toxic" respectively, to be released instead. It was finally announced as a single after it was selected as the theme song for the 2004 film
Catwoman. "Outrageous" is an
R&B song with influences of
hip hop and an exotic feel. Lyrically, it talks about
materialism and entertainment. "Outrageous" received mixed reviews from critics. Some praised its funky sound, while others deemed it as "forgettable".
